Yes, our COC winners do send to entries to AHA COC Nationals.
By adding more competitions would put undo strain on the individuals who already coordinate/judge/stewart the current COCs. The COC do not happen by them selves. A lot of effort and goes into planning and conducting a COC. The Comp Coordinator has to collect entries, log them, recruit judges, organize a time, conduct the event, and report the results. Not to mention that a typical COC judging session is 2-3 hours depending upon the number of entries. Another issue is that we already have difficulty recruiting Judges/Stewarts for the 6 COCs we already have.
Adding more competitions is just not the answer. What value would that add, especially when we already have 6 COCs and 8 LSCs. If an individual can’t get the feedback that they require from these events, then IMHO they are not really trying.

OK, here's my .02...
We have 2 awards, 1 for the COC as it is, and 1 for an overall competition that combines the COC points and the Lonestar points.
Brewing for the Lonestar Circuit requires a large investment of time and money. Not everyone can or wants to do this. The COC, as is, provides a competion for all club members to compete. It provides a variety of styles, and the winner must be a good and versatile brewer.
The brewers who make the investment of time and money for the competions in the Lonestar Circuit deserve recognition as well. My proposal to combine COC and Lonestar points allows us to recognize the Lonestar brewers, while keeping the COC relevant. Those who want to win this overall competion will want to participate in the COC for the points. Since participation in the COC has been down, this may help increase interest.
With enough interest in the COC in the future, there may be an opportunity to make future changes that some have suggested, such as adding competitions. I, personally, would like to see a mead and a cider among the competitions every year, even if we have to add these ourselves.
That's my proposal. I plan to make it to The Flying Saucer to discuss this with whoever can make it.
